Ramsay’s Kitchen Nightmares’ as Maze’s Jason Atherton Resigns
Another one bites the dust” as they say, but surely not in such quick succession? With Mark Sargeant having tendered his resignation just 4 months ago to ‘Work on other projects”, Chef patron of Gordon Ramsay’s Maze restaurant, Jason Atherton seems to have followed suit by tendering his resignation also.

Verjuice launches Nationwide
Verjuice has recently become available to British home cooks and chefs alike. This versatile product is made from the unfermented juice of unripe wine grapes, pressed from the green-harvested thinnings that, we are told, are high in acid and low in sugar. Its versatility as a flavour enhancer makes it an excellent alternative to lemon juice, vinegar or wine in your cooking.
